Realign code with the 2026-07-29 findings-resolution rulings
Nine rulings land as code. Reorders don't stamp — one container-change predicate (WriteOperation.rewritesOrderOnly): within-container reorders and the renumber rescale rewrite only order, while cross-lane, cross-board, and trash moves stamp modified and clear modified-by; no trash special case exists, and the m8 undo inverses conform through the same seam. Copies are transactions: the root-strict/nested-lenient split retires for a whole-subtree stampability preflight that refuses loudly naming the offender, and every item-level copy severs remote/remote-state at every level (whole-board forks carry them verbatim). Paste refuses, never degrades: the embedded-index.md materialization and its loss row retire; a missing staged snapshot produces nothing and posts an error-tone one-shot named from manifest metadata. Coerce-tier fallbacks log through the Defect stream with path context attached loader-side. Displacement is level-uniform: a file squatting attachments inside a card heals by the same rename ladder as board-root squatters; comments stays tolerated. Delete Immediately joins card and lane context menus as Delete's ⌥-alternate with its own VO custom action, routed through an explicit container so the menu target outranks standing selection. Agent guide v7 teaches the stamp discipline and the card-level attachments claim, and sheds two stale v6 lines (lanes trash now; kind is taught). Verified conformant, unchanged: edition-aware Undo/Redo disable, trash marquee full-height backdrop. Both schemes 1854 tests / 318 suites green; verify-editions 30/30.
